The journey of hand-drawn noodles begins with skilled artisans whose expertise has been honed over generations. The creation of these noodles is both an art and a science, rooted in tradition yet constantly evolving. The dough, typically made from wheat flour, salt, and water, is kneaded to the perfect consistency, allowing it to stretch without breaking. This delicate balance is achieved through years of practice, showcasing true craftsmanship. The drawing process is where the magic truly happens. Master chefs use their hands to meticulously stretch the dough, engaging in a rhythmic dance that transforms a simple mixture into long, supple noodles. This highly skilled technique not only results in noodles with an extraordinary texture but also adds a human touch that is absent in mass-produced alternatives. Each noodle is infused with the chef's dedication and passion, providing an authentic culinary experience that reverberates with every bite.
